RESOLUTION NO. 2009 -40
A RESOLUTION OF THE CITY COMMISSION OF
WINTER SPRINGS, FLORIDA, RESPECTFULLY
ENCOURAGING SEMINOLE COUNTY TO MAINTAIN
AND APPROPRIATELY FUND THE COUNTY'S PUBLIC
LIBRARY SYSTEM; SUPPORTING SEMINOLE
COUNTY'S PLANNING EFFORTS TO STUDY
INNOVATIVE LIBRARY MANAGEMENT STRATEGIES
AND PROGRESSIVE LIBRARY MANAGEMENT
SERVICES; OPPOSING PRIVATIZATION OF THE
COUNTY'S PUBLIC LIBRARY SYSTEM THAT COULD
NEGATIVELY IMPACT THE LEVEL OF SERVICES
CURRENTLY ENJOYED BY THE CITIZENS OF
SEMINOLE COUNTY; PROVIDING AN EFFECTIVE
DATE.
WHEREAS, the City understands that Seminole County is currently requesting
proposals for library management services for Seminole County's public library system; and
WHEREAS, the City supports Seminole County's planning efforts to find innovative
management strategies and progressive library management services; and
WHEREAS, the City Commission has, however, recently received comments from
citizens expressing concern that Seminole County may be considering privatizing the public
library system and that privatizing said system may potentially reduce levels of service; and
WHEREAS, the City Commission believes that the Seminole County's public library
system is a tremendous asset to the community that should be preserved and appropriately
funded by Seminole County; and
WHEREAS, the City Commission opposes any efforts to privatize Seminole County's
public library system that could negatively impact the level of services currently enjoyed by the
citizens of Seminole County; and
WHEREAS, the City Commission of Winter Springs finds that this Resolution is in the
best interests of the public health, safety, and welfare of the citizens of Winter Springs.
NOW THEREFORE, THE CITY COMMISSION OF THE CITY OF WINTER
SPRINGS HEREBY RESOLVES, AS FOLLOWS:

Section 2. City Commission's Statement. The City Commission hereby respectfully
advises Seminole County as follows:
A. The City Commission encourages Seminole County to maintain and appropriately
fund the County's public library system.
B. The City Commission opposes privatizing the County's public library system that
could negatively impact the level of service currently enjoyed by the citizens of Seminole
County.
Section 3. Effective Date. This Resolution shall become effective immediately upon
adoption by the City Commission.
